Pixel 4a appears on French online retailers in Just Black and Blue

The Google Pixel 4a is arriving at some point soon. A new report from Android World spotted the Pixel 4a appear on two French online retailers’ websites: Ordimedia and eStock.fr. Two colors are listed for the Pixel 4a including Just Black, and Blue. This is contradictory to reports that Google had scrapped a blue option for the 4a and may only launch a black model.

The Black version has a model number GA02099-FR and the Blue one is GA02101-FR. In addition, the models are listed as having 128GB of onboard storage and showing an estimated delivery “within 8 to 12 business days” from eStock.fr, and Ordimedia shows an ETA of July 7. The prices listed are €506 and €441, respectively.

The Google Pixel 4a is reportedly going to be announced on July 13, so we’re not too confident about the accuracy of these delivery dates, and the prices seem a bit high. We are under the impression that these listings might simply be placeholders for the website until the Pixel 4a becomes official.

Based on recent reports, the Google Pixel 4a will be announced on July 13 and (supposedly) won’t be released until October 22.

The Pixel 4a will be powered by the Snapdragon 730 CPU and sport a 5.81-inch OLED screen with FHD+ resolution and a punch-hole 8MP selfie camera. There’s 12.2MP main camera, which we anticipate will take stellar photos thanks to Google software. There’s also a 3,080 mAh battery and a 3.5mm headphone jack.
